On the existence of non-free totally reflexive modules

Abstract
For a standard graded Cohen-Macaulay ring , if the quotient admits non-free totally reflexive modules, where is a system of parameters consisting of elements of degree one, then so does the ring . As an application, we consider the question of which Stanley-Reisner rings of graphs admit non-free totally reflexive modules.
